1. 关注常识网首页
  2. 生活常识

CodeBlocks打造标准的C、C++集成开发环境的教程 安装与配置

安装与配置下载CodeBlocks:可以从官方网站下载适合您操作系统的CodeBlocks版本。它是一款开源的跨平台集成开发环境,支持Windows、macOS...

安装与配置下载CodeBlocks:可以从官方网站下载适合您操作系统的CodeBlocks版本。它是一款开源的跨平台集成....更多详细,我们一起来了解吧。

CodeBlocks打造标准的C、C++集成开发环境的教程 安装与配置

CodeBlocks打造标准的C、C++集成开发环境的教程

安装与配置

下载CodeBlocks:可以从官方网站下载适合您操作系统的CodeBlocks版本。它是一款开源的跨平台集成开发环境,支持Windows、macOS和Linux等系统。

安装过程

在Windows系统下,下载完成后,运行安装程序,按照安装向导的提示进行操作。一般来说,默认设置就可以满足大多数需求。

在Linux系统中,可以通过软件包管理器进行安装,例如在Ubuntu系统中,可以使用sudo apt - get install codeblocks命令进行安装(具体命令可能因Linux发行版而异)。

安装完成后,可能需要配置编译器。CodeBlocks可以与多种编译器配合使用,如在Windows系统下常用的MinGW编译器。可以在CodeBlocks的设置中指定编译器的路径等相关配置信息。

创建项目(以C语言为例)

新建项目

打开CodeBlocks,选择File - New - Project。

选择ConsoleApplication,然后点击Go按钮。

点击Next,接着选择是编写C还是C++程序,这里选择C程序。

再点击Next后给项目命名,例如命名为“MyCProject”。

点击Next,可以选择编译器等等,这里默认不动。

点击Finish,此时会出现自动生成的Source目录和main.c文件(如果是C++则为main.cpp文件)。

添加源文件和头文件(如果需要)

添加源文件:可以使用快捷键Ctrl + Shift + N,点击YES后按照提示操作。

添加头文件:方法与添加源文件类似,并且CodeBlocks能够自动识别文件类型,如果是头文件,则会放入相应的文件夹。

编写代码

在CodeBlocks的代码编辑区域编写C或C++代码。它提供了一些方便的功能,例如语法高亮、代码折叠、自动完成和参数提示等功能,有助于提高编码效率。

编译与构建

单个源文件编译(如果只有一个源文件)

如果您的程序只有一个源文件(初学者基本上都是在单个源文件下编写代码),可以不创建项目,直接操作。打开CodeBlocks,选择文件 - 新建 - 空白文件,保存时将源文件后缀名改为.c(C语言)或者.cpp(C++语言)。然后在上方菜单栏中选择构建 - 构建,就可以完成编译工作(也可以使用快捷键Ctrl+F9)。编译完成后,会在源文件所在的目录生成目标文件(如hello.o)和可执行文件(如hello.exe)。

项目编译(如果是项目中有多个源文件)

对于有多个源文件的项目,在编写完代码后,选择构建 - 构建来编译整个项目。如果编译成功,会生成可执行文件。

构建并运行快捷方式

在实际开发中,还可以使用菜单中的构建 - 构建并运行选项,这样可以一步完成编译和运行操作,查看程序的输出结果。

调试(可选)

CodeBlocks提供了调试功能,例如设置断点、单步执行等操作,帮助开发者查找代码中的错误。不过最新版本(如20.03版)可能存在调试自动退出等问题,但有一些特定的压缩包版本声称解决了这个调试问题。具体的调试操作如下:

在代码中设置断点:在想要暂停程序执行的代码行左侧点击,会出现一个红点,表示断点设置成功。

启动调试:选择调试 - 开始/继续,程序会运行到第一个断点处停止。

单步执行:可以选择调试 - 单步进入、调试 - 单步跳过或者调试 - 单步跳出等操作来逐行执行代码,观察变量的值和程序的执行流程。

以上就是小编为你精心整理的CodeBlocks打造标准的C、C++集成开发环境的教程的全部内容,更多关于《安装与配置》相关内容请收藏我们的关注常识网。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人,并不代表关注常识网立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容(包括不限于图片和视频等),请邮件至379184938@qq.com 举报,一经查实,本站将立刻删除。

联系我们

在线咨询:点击这里给我发消息

微信号:CHWK6868

工作日:9:30-18:30,节假日休息